Hainan Hare vs Roloway Monkey
Lepus hainanus compared with Cercopithecus roloway
Key Differences
- Hainan Hare is Endangered while Roloway Monkey is Critically Endangered.
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Hainan Hare | Roloway Monkey |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class same | Mammalia (Mammals)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Lagomorpha (Rabbits & Hares) | Primates (Primates) |
| Family | Leporidae (Rabbits & Hares) | Cercopithecidae (Old World Monkeys) |
| Genus | Lepus | Cercopithecus |
| Species | Lepus hainanus | Cercopithecus roloway |
Evolutionary Relationship
Hainan Hare and Roloway Monkey share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(Mammals)
